Now, let's dig into the maintenance cost. There are several factors that can affect how much you'll end up spending on keeping your high torque hub motor in top shape.

1. Components Wear and Tear

One of the main contributors to maintenance cost is the wear and tear of components. Just like any other mechanical device, the parts in a high torque hub motor will gradually wear out over time.

  • Bearings: Bearings are crucial for the smooth rotation of the motor. They reduce friction between moving parts. Over time, the constant rotation and stress can cause the bearings to wear out. When this happens, you might notice a strange noise coming from the motor or a decrease in its efficiency. Replacing bearings can be a bit costly, depending on the type and quality of the bearings used in the motor. A good quality bearing set can cost anywhere from $20 to $100, and if you need to pay a mechanic to install them, that'll add to the cost.
  • Brushes and Commutators (for brushed motors): In brushed high torque hub motors, the brushes and commutators are subject to wear. The brushes transfer electrical current to the commutator, which then distributes it to the motor's coils. As the brushes rub against the commutator, they gradually wear down. When the brushes are worn out, the motor may lose power or stop working altogether. Replacing brushes is relatively inexpensive, usually costing around $10 - $30, but you also need to consider the cost of labor if you're not doing it yourself.

2. Electrical Issues

Electrical problems can also drive up the maintenance cost.

  • Wiring: The wiring in a high torque hub motor can get damaged due to factors like vibration, moisture, or physical impact. A frayed or broken wire can cause a short circuit, which can not only damage the motor but also pose a safety hazard. Repairing or replacing wiring can be tricky, especially if the wiring is hidden inside the motor housing. Depending on the complexity of the repair, it could cost anywhere from $50 to a few hundred dollars.
  • Controller Problems: The motor controller is like the brain of the high torque hub motor. It regulates the power supply to the motor, ensuring smooth operation. If the controller malfunctions, the motor may not work properly. Controller issues can be caused by overheating, electrical surges, or software glitches. Replacing a motor controller can be quite expensive, often costing $100 - $300 or more, depending on the model and features.

3. Environmental Factors

The environment in which the high torque hub motor operates can have a significant impact on its maintenance cost.

  • Dust and Dirt: If the motor is exposed to a lot of dust and dirt, these particles can get into the motor and cause damage. They can clog the cooling vents, which can lead to overheating. Dust and dirt can also wear down the moving parts more quickly. Regular cleaning can help prevent this, but if the motor has already been contaminated, you may need to disassemble it for a thorough cleaning, which can be time - consuming and may require professional help.
  • Moisture: Moisture is another enemy of high torque hub motors. Water can cause corrosion of the electrical components and rusting of the metal parts. If the motor gets wet, it's important to dry it out as soon as possible. In some cases, water damage can be so severe that it requires the replacement of major components.

4. Usage Patterns

How you use the high torque hub motor also affects its maintenance cost.

  • Heavy Loads: If you frequently use the motor to carry heavy loads, it will put more stress on the components. This can cause the bearings, gears (if any), and other parts to wear out faster. For example, if you're using an e - bike with a high torque hub motor to transport heavy groceries or equipment on a regular basis, you'll likely need to replace components more often compared to someone who uses the e - bike for light commuting.
  • High - Speed Riding: Riding at high speeds for extended periods can also increase the wear and tear on the motor. The higher the speed, the more stress is placed on the components, and the more heat is generated. This can lead to faster degradation of the motor's parts.

Reducing Maintenance Cost

There are ways to keep the maintenance cost of a high torque hub motor down.

  • Regular Maintenance: Performing regular maintenance tasks, such as cleaning the motor, checking the components for wear, and lubricating the moving parts, can go a long way in preventing major problems. You can do some of these tasks yourself, which will save you money on labor costs.
  • Quality Components: When it comes time to replace components, it's worth investing in high - quality parts. While they may cost more upfront, they're likely to last longer and perform better, reducing the frequency of replacements.
